Stag Lying Down
| Title | Stag Lying Down |
|---|---|
| Artist | Rosa Bonheur (French, 1822–1899) |
| Date | c. 1875–85 19th century |
| Medium | watercolor and gouache over graphite on cream wove paper |
| Classification | Drawing |
| Origin | France, 19th century France |
| Holding institution | The Cleveland Museum of Art |
| Credit line | Stag Lying Down, c. 1875–85. Rosa Bonheur (French, 1822–1899). Watercolor and gouache over graphite on cream wove paper; sheet: 28 x 38.1 cm (11 x 15 in.). The Cleveland Museum of Art, James Parmelee Fund, 1977.3 |
| Rights | Public domain (CC0). Free to use for any purpose. |
About this artwork
“Stag Lying Down” is a work by Rosa Bonheur (French, 1822–1899), dated c. 1875–85. It is executed in watercolor and gouache over graphite on cream wove paper and classified as drawing. US vs EU note: in the United States a faithful photographic reproduction of a public-domain 2-D artwork carries no new copyright (Bridgeman v. Corel), which is the basis of these open-access programmes. EU Directive 2019/790 Art. 14 similarly provides that reproductions of public-domain visual works are not protected. If reusing commercially in another jurisdiction, satisfy yourself of the local position. See the full licence note.
